Interrobang‽, Jillian and Katherine discuss
Justine Sacco, whose offensive tweet about AIDS in Africa went viral. Did Sacco deserve to lose her job at a
PR firm? They then turn to the recent
federal court ruling against the NSA and consider whether privacy advocates should place their faith in politicians or in judges. Can the
tech sector develop products to protect users’ privacy? Jillian condemns the
United Arab Emirates for its crackdown on online satire. Should the
American Studies Association boycott Israeli academics? Plus: How
Egypt‘s military rulers continue to arrest civil society activists.
